About Minecraft
Minecraft is a global sandbox gaming phenomenon where players explore infinite worlds and build everything from simple homes to grand castles. Owned by Microsoft and developed by Mojang Studios, it is the best-selling video game of all time and a staple of creative and educational play.
Minecraft offers an unparalleled, infinite creative canvas with total player agency, supported by a cross-platform ecosystem and an massive global community of creators and modders.
Target audience: Minecraft serves a massive, multi-generational audience ranging from elementary school children and their parents to hardcore technical builders and educators. It appeals to creative minds looking for a digital canvas, survival enthusiasts seeking adventure, and teachers using the platform as a STEM learning tool.
